Thatcher takes aim at British Airways tail logos DIRK BEVERIDGE October 9, 1997 GMT ``We fly the British flag, not these awful things you are putting on tails,″ Lady Thatcher told the British Airways workers who happened to be on duty at a corporate booth set up for the annual conference of the opposition Conservative Party.

'Open day' event for BA staff and their guests. LONDON (AP) _ British Airways must have hoped the last shot had been fired at its new tail designs _ but ex-prime minister Margaret Thatcher on Thursday raised her still-influential voice against the removal of the Union Jack logos.
